The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Charles Hinds, born in 1836 in Liverpool, Lancashire, consisted of 7 members. Charles was the head of the household, married to Agnes Hinds, born in 1842 in Whorlton, Durham, England. They had 5 children; Charles J (born 1869 in Liverpool, Lancashire, England), Agnes M M (born 1870 in Whorlton, Durham, England), John W (born 1872 in Hackney, Middlesex, England), Mary L M (born 1878 in Durham, Durham, England) and Mary G (born 1880 in Fulham, Middlesex, England).
